4,5-Dimethoxypyridin-3-amine
4,5-Dimethoxypyridin-3-amine (CAS: 1087659-17-3) is a pyridine derivative with the molecular formula C7H10N2O2 and a molecular weight of 154.17 g/mol. It serves as a valuable heterocyclic building block in chemical synthesis. This compound is primarily utilised in research and development settings for the creation of novel chemical entities and advanced materials. Its structural features make it a useful intermediate for further chemical transformations.
